Celebrating MATEC’s Legacy and Plans for the Future

By Estela Balderas | September 28, 2024 | 0

September 27, 2024: After 21 years with MATEC at the University of Illinois at Chicago College of Medicine, Department of Family and Community Medicine, Dr. Ricardo Rivero will retire, effective September 30, 2024. His next chapter will be open to sharing with his family, including his three dogs, and contributing to the HIV prevention efforts…
